WebThe Georgia Music Hall of Fame was located in downtown Macon, Georgia, United States, from 1996 until it closed in 2011.The Hall of Fame preserved and interpreted the state's musical heritage through programs of collection, exhibition, education and performance; it attempted to foster an appreciation for Georgia music and tried to stimulate Economic …

WebThe Georgia Music Hall of Fame in Macon served for fifteen years as the state's official music museum.
